Zolon’s project management processes are derived from the Project Management Body of Knowledge—PMBOK—best practices defined by the Project Management Institute (PMI) with iterative development built-in where required. PMBOK is an internationally recognized IEEE standard that documents and standardizes generally accept project management practices. Published by PMI, PMBOK recognizes 5 basic process groups and 9 knowledge areas typical of projects that we deliver.
